Unveiling the H. T. Parekh Legacy Centre in Mumbai with Focused Audio

This summer the HDFC Ltd (Housing Development Finance Corporation Limited) and H. T. Parekh Foundation proudly announced the grand opening of the H. T. Parekh Legacy Centre, a remarkable tribute to the visionary Hasmukhlal Thakordas Parekh. Located on the 4th floor of HDFC’s corporate headquarters at Ramon House, Churchgate, Mumbai, this Legacy Centre honors the life and achievements of a man whose dreams revolutionized the housing finance landscape in India.

H. T. Parekh Legacy Centre in Mumbai with SoundTube Focused AudioMr. Hasmukhlal Thakordas Parekh, affectionately known as H. T. Parekh, embarked on a journey to bring housing finance to India at the age of 65. After relinquishing his role as Chairman of ICICI Limited, he founded HDFC, realizing his lifelong dream. The H. T. Parekh Legacy Centre chronicles his incredible story, from his early life and years as a stockbroker to the establishment of ICICI as a development bank and the founding of HDFC in 1977.

The Legacy Centre is designed to reflect the simplicity and warmth that defined Mr. H.T. Parekh. Abhishek Ray of Matrika Design Collaborative brought this vision to life by incorporating arches reminiscent of pre-Independence British architecture, creating spatial niches that guide visitors through different areas. The center culminates with the “historic space,” preserving Mr. H. T. Parekh’s original hut, symbolizing the roots of HDFC.

Audiovisual elements played a pivotal role in enhancing the visitor experience at the Legacy Centre. Abhishek Ray was tasked with providing a contained audio solution for the walk-through gallery, allowing visitors to immerse themselves in personal interviews and audio content featuring Mr. H. T. Parekh and the dedicated team behind HDFC’s inception.

After careful consideration, SoundTube was selected for its aesthetic appeal and comprehensive package, aligning perfectly with the project’s requirements. Blitzkrieg Systems collaborated to design and supply the audio-video equipment, selecting SoundTube’s Focus Point FP6020-II with SA202-RDT-II Amplifiers and HDMI Matrix switches for AV signal routing.

The contained audio solution featured:

  • FP6020-II Focus Point parabolas powered by SA202-RDT-II Mini stereo amplifiers, known for their space-saving design.
  • Two Focus Point pods equipped with LED and motion-sensing modules to elevate the user experience.
  • Samsung commercial displays strategically placed throughout the venue.
  • Alfatron Electronics matrix switches employing HDBaseT technology to transmit Ultra HD AV signals over long distances.
  • Precise planning ensured that each Focal Point FP6020-II loudspeaker was installed not more than 7.5 feet from the floor level, optimizing sound containment.
  • Floor rugs were strategically placed under each Focus Point pod to minimize sound reflections and maximize audio directivity.

H. T. Parekh Legacy Centre in Mumbai with SoundTube Focal PointThe complete list of products installed included:

SoundTube FP6020-II x 6

SoundTube SA202-RDT-II x 6

SoundTube FP-Motion x 2

SoundTube FP-LED x 2

Alfatron Electronics ALF MUH44E x 1

Alfatron Electronics ALF WUK4A x 1

The end result was an unparalleled level of audio directivity and a flawless experience for visitors to the Legacy Centre. Abhishek Ray from Matrika praised SoundTube’s technology, highlighting its reliability and exceptional support.

The H. T. Parekh Legacy Centre was inaugurated by Jamshyd N. Godrej, Chairman and Managing Director of Godrej & Boyce Mfg. Ltd. Co. and opened to the public in July 2023. It stands as a testament to the enduring legacy of Mr. H. T. Parekh and his vision for a better India.
